If anyone can help I would be grateful.
Cahnged diesel filter today as would not pull past 3000 rpm, now pulls like express train but EML now on, Could it be a faulty water sensor. Using BOSCH filter, nothing else has changed.

Reset by switching off, disconnect battery for at least 30 secs the restart and allow to idle for 2 mins.. all will be reset.
